Which answer best describes the solution to the equation
3m – 9 = 9 + 3m?

A.
one solution

B.
no solution

C.
an infinite number of solutions

D.
m = 27

let's check
3m - 9 = 9+3m
collect like terms
3m -3m = 9 + 9
0m = 18
which is not possible, so it will not have any solutions
